 | |  | | E-book Category: History, Mystery, Novels E-book Title: Kill Or Curare Author: Nigel Woodhead Book Description: A novel of historical crime and conspiracy. May 1897. A self-destructive Academy award Wilde, simply discharged from two years in prison, arrives in Dieppe, Normandy, under the assumed name of Sebastian Melmoth. On the same ferry is Captain Drake Hastings, sent by British Prime Minister Lord Salisbury, apparently to "protect national interests", and to investigate conspiracies amongst the large British ex-pat community in Dieppe. Hastings shortly discovers there is far worse below the skin of the chic resort than mere political intrigue: against a "Naughty Nineties" background of illness and drugs, of vice and violence, a serial killer appears to be responsible for the abductions and murders of some English prostitutes working in the town, as well as the detectives sent by mysterious third parties. Some
the English and French authorities are queerly keen to cover up these crimes. Crimes which echo those of the Whitechapel (Ripper) murders of 1888, and others Hastings recalls from his tour of duty in India. The plot develops during the summer societal Season, the period leading up to Academy award Wilde's departure for Paris. Hastings infiltrates Wilde's clique of decadent, bohemian writers and artists, assisted by the eccentric Doctor Dinan, and by paranoid painter, Bruno walter Sickert. It shortly becomes clean that Hastings himself is a blemished hero with a murky mandate. A man with a private secret past related to his service in the Hussars in India, and who doses himself daily with arsenic, against malaria. He meets Lady Middenware (a "Society hostess" and friend of Lord Salisbury, but besides madam of the town's most exclusive English brothel). He has a torrid affair with her adopted "niece", Alice. A drug addict like her aunt, Alice lives in a dream earth of fictional lamia tales.
